Best MB for a 4770k to OC and run 2-3 GPU

Well, for 3 GPUs none of those will be sufficient; you'll need a motherboard with a PLX Chip that allows 4 way SLI. Most mainstream boards will only allow a 3rd gpu in x4, while a PLX motherboard allows x8 times four (or times three). I don't think any such Z87 workstation boards are out yet, but there are some Z77 boards such as the P8Z77 WS. That obviously won't work for the 4770k, but I think another such board is in the works for Z87. Not sure if any of the Z87 workstation boards are out yet. Be aware that quad sli and tri SLI workstation boards cost a ton.

For dual GPU i'd actually recommend paying a bit more for the Asus Z87 pro. The sabertooth is a similar board to the Z87 pro but you're paying 40$ more for the TUF armor.
 
Maybe I'm not techie enough to understand but the asrock and other said 3 way or 4 way sli. Here is the description for the asrock

With 4th generation 'Haswell' Intel Core processor support, full PCI-E 3.0 and 4-Way SLI and CrossFire support, this motherboard is ready for the future of high performance computing

Also says 3 3.0 16x PCI-e.

Help me understand
 
X87 chipsets have 16 pci lanes. Those mobos "can" run 3 way sli, it would just be 8x, 4x, 4x (adds up to 16 lanes). which less than ideal. You want at least 8x per lane, which can only be accomplished with a plx chip, which are very expensive. Think around $400 mobos (Maximus Extreme, MSI Xpower, etc). 2 way sli is no problem with your listed mobo. You technically are able to run 3 way, but they will be bottlenecked by the 4x lane speed.
